Output 8bb7a086312368a7b6da9744cfea323530c09ce48b0d0ed3983198d623296058:0

value
1650149
script pubkey
OP_0 OP_PUSHBYTES_32 d011f5447500e9e1ef30cb166bf43f06f75e92f847d8594d9ea67f87f1986e9a
address
bc1q6qgl23r4qr57rmesevtxhaplqmm4ayhcglv9jnv75elc0uvcd6dqasx829
transaction
8bb7a086312368a7b6da9744cfea323530c09ce48b0d0ed3983198d623296058
confirmations
86331
spent
true